Fascia Replacement in Alpharetta, GA
Fascia replacement services involve removing and installing new fascia boards, which are the horizontal strips that run along the edge of the roofline. These boards help support the gutters and protect the roof and walls from water damage. Projects typically include replacing damaged or rotting fascia caused by weather exposure, pests, or age, as well as upgrading worn-out materials for improved durability. Homeowners often request fascia replacement when they notice peeling paint, sagging gutters, or signs of wood deterioration along the roofline.
Before requesting fascia replacement, property owners usually want to understand the extent of damage and the best materials for their home’s style and climate. It’s important to consider whether the existing fascia needs complete removal or if repairs are sufficient. Proper installation ensures the fascia functions effectively to support gutters and prevent water infiltration, which can lead to further structural issues. Consulting with a professional can help determine the appropriate approach to maintaining the integrity and appearance of the roofline.

Fascia Replacement Questions
What is fascia replacement? Fascia replacement involves removing damaged or decayed fascia boards and installing new ones to protect the roof and improve the property's appearance.
Why might fascia need replacement? Fascia can deteriorate due to weather exposure, pests, or age, leading to potential roof damage and water leaks.
What materials are used for fascia replacement? Common materials include wood, vinyl, and aluminum, chosen based on durability and aesthetic preferences.
How does fascia replacement benefit a property? Replacing damaged fascia helps prevent water intrusion, protects roof structures, and enhances curb appeal.
